The Rut: A Season of Mating

The rut, or the breeding season, is a critical phase in the whitetail deer reproductive cycle. It typically occurs during the fall months, with the exact timing varying depending on geographical location and environmental factors. During this period, male deer, known as bucks, become highly aggressive and competitive as they vie for the attention of female deer, or does.
- Dominant bucks will often engage in physical battles to establish their dominance and win the right to mate with does.
- The rut is characterized by increased vocalizations, scent marking, and aggressive behavior as bucks strive to assert their dominance.
- Does, on the other hand, will enter a period of estrus, or heat, during which they become receptive to mating.

The Gestation Period: A Journey of Growth and Development

Once conception has occurred, the doe embarks on a remarkable journey of gestation, nurturing and supporting the developing fawn(s) within her womb. The gestation period for whitetail deer typically lasts around 200 days, although this can vary slightly depending on various factors.

The Birth of Fawns: A Miracle of Nature

The birth of fawns is a truly remarkable event, a testament to the resilience and adaptability of nature. After a gestation period of approximately 200 days, the doe gives birth to one or more fawns, each weighing around 5 to 8 pounds.

Post-Birth Care and Bonding

After the birth, the doe and her fawn(s) enter a critical period of bonding and care. The doe will remain with her fawn(s) for the first few weeks, providing them with milk and protection. This early bonding is essential for the fawn(s) to recognize their mother's scent and voice, ensuring their survival in the wild.
- The doe will continue to nurse her fawn(s) for several months, gradually weaning them off her milk as they begin to forage for themselves.
- As the fawn(s) grow and develop, they will begin to follow their mother, learning essential survival skills and behaviors.

How many fawns do whitetail deer typically give birth to?

+
Whitetail deer typically give birth to one or two fawns, although in some cases, they may have triplets or even quadruplets. The number of fawns born depends on various factors, including the health and condition of the doe, as well as environmental conditions.
